¿Problemas con FlashPlayer y Firefox 21+? Acá la solución

Como muchos saben uso Debian, y la instalación de Firefox la hago de forma manual por muchos motivos siguiendo estos pasos.

Sucede que con la salida de Firefox 21, FlashPlayer comenzó a presentar problemas, no de errores, sino de que el navegador no lo encontraba.

Normalmente se podía usar FlashPlayer en Firefox como se explica en este artículo. Pero ya no.

Esto se debe a que con Firefox 21, ya no se usa la carpeta ~/.mozilla/plugins/ para FlashPlayer, sino que la ruta cambió. Ahora la carpeta plugins se encuentra dentro del directorio donde se encuentra instalado Firefox.

Por ejemplo, en mi caso, yo cuando descomprimo el .tar.gz, copio la carpeta firefox en ~/.local/apps/, por lo tanto ahora los pasos a seguir son los siguientes:

1- Descargo la última versión de FlashPlayer para 64Bits:

cd ~
$ wget http://fpdownload.macromedia.com/get/flashplayer/pdc/11.2.202.285/install_flash_player_11_linux.x86_64.tar.gz

2- Descomprimo el .tar.gz:

$ tar xfv install_flash_player_11_linux.x86_64.tar.gz

Esto nos extrae 2 ficheros y una carpeta:

  • readme.txt
  • libflashplayer.so
  • usr/

4- Creamos la carpeta plugins dentro del directorio donde está instalado Firefox, en mi caso sería:

$ mkdir ~/.local/apps/firefox/plugins

En algunos foros he visto que la carpeta plugins si no funciona en esa ruta, debe estar en ~/.local/apps/firefox/browser/plugins

Para que no haya problemas con esto, creamos un enlace simbólico:

$ ln -s ~/.local/apps/firefox/plugins ~/.local/apps/firefox/browser/plugins

5- Copiamos el fichero libflashplayer.so:

$ cp libflashplayer.so ~/.local/apps/firefox/plugins

6- Copiamos el contenido de la carpeta /usr  al directorio /usr:

$ sudo cp -Rv usr/* /usr

Con esto debe ser suficiente. Si por algún motivo sigue sin funcionar, abrimos una nueva pestaña, tecleamos about:config y buscamos el parámetro:

plugins.load_appdir_plugins

Y si está en false lo ponemos en true.

Listo. Siguiendo estos pasos ya tengo funcionando de nuevo FlashPlayer, aunque casi no lo use 